欢迎来到“澎湃教育网”,在这里您可以浏览到国内最新的基础教育信息、教育改革政策、教育创业报道、在线教育活动,以及课程改革信息,中考备战,高考备战,家长学校等各类资讯。

主页 > 新闻 > vue获取每个月法定假日_vue获取年月日

vue获取每个月法定假日_vue获取年月日

来源:网络转载更新时间:2023-09-19 08:40:04阅读:

本篇文章809字,读完约2分钟

南通云对讲

如何使用Vue获取每个月的法定假日?

在Vue中,我们可以通过一些技巧和方法来获取每个月的法定假日。下面介绍了一种常用的方法:

使用moment.js库来获取年月日

在Vue中,我们可以使用moment.js库来处理日期。Moment.js是一个非常有用的JavaScript日期库,它可以帮助我们处理、格式化和计算日期。

安装moment.js库

首先,我们需要在项目中安装moment.js库。可以通过npm或yarn安装:

npm install moment
yarn add moment

在Vue组件中引入moment.js库

在需要使用moment.js的Vue组件中,我们可以通过import语句引入moment.js库:

import moment from "moment";

使用moment.js获取每个月的法定假日

一旦我们引入了moment.js库,就可以使用它来获取每个月的法定假日。下面是一个示例代码:

// 获取当前年份和月份
const year = moment().year();
const month = moment().month() + 1;
// 构造当前月份的第一天和最后一天日期
const firstDayOfMonth = moment(`${year}-${month}-01`);
const lastDayOfMonth = firstDayOfMonth.clone().endOf("month");
// 循环遍历每一天,判断是否是法定假日
for (let day = firstDayOfMonth; day <= lastDayOfMonth; day.add(1, "day")) {
  if (day.isHoliday()) {
    console.log(day.format("YYYY-MM-DD") + "是法定假日");
  }
}

通过上述方法,我们可以获取每个月的法定假日。根据实际需求,可以进一步处理日期格式、展示假日等。

总结

通过使用moment.js库,我们可以方便地获取每个月的法定假日。这种方法可以帮助我们处理和计算日期,让我们的开发工作更加高效。

标题:vue获取每个月法定假日_vue获取年月日

地址:http://www.ptwc.com.cn/xw/19125.html

免责声明:澎湃教育网是国内权威的教育门户网站,发布的内容来自于网络,本站不为其真实性负责,只为传播网络信息为目的,非商业用途,如有异议请及时联系btr2031@163.com,澎湃教育网的李湘将予以删除。

澎湃教育网介绍

澎湃教育网一直秉承以“专注教育,用心服务”为核心,在专注全球教育市场开拓的同时,为超过一百多所院校提供推广服务,优质、用心的服务赢得了众多院校的信赖和好评。以宣传报道各国教育信息为主的国际性教育网络媒体,本网立足于国内外教育行业,依托各大院校、商学院、国际学校,以及中外合作项目、留学移民等教育实体,向全球传播教育类信息资讯。